What Is OKX?
Founded in 2017 (originally as OKEx), OKX is a Seychelles-based crypto trading platform serving 50 million users across 100+ countries. It specializes in blockchain-based financial services and ranks among the top 10 crypto exchanges by daily trading volume (over $1 billion).
Key Features:
- Margin Trading: Up to 100x leverage
- Spot Trading: 650+ trading pairs (BTC, ETH, USDT, etc.)
- Crypto Loans: Earn interest by lending assets
- Options Trading: Advanced contracts for experienced traders
Is OKX Safe?
Security is critical in crypto, and OKX excels with:
- Multi-Factor Authentication (MFA)
- Cold Wallet Storage for offline private keys
- OKX Risk Shield: Reserve funds for asset protection
- Anti-Phishing Codes via email
OKX Fees
OKX offers competitive fees:
- Standard Users: 0.08% maker / 0.1% taker
- VIP Users: As low as 0.02% maker / 0.05% taker
- Futures Trading: 0.02% maker / 0.05% taker
Discounts apply for holding OKB tokens (OKX’s native token).

OKX Review: Cons
1. Not Beginner-Friendly
Advanced features like margin trading and options require experience.
2. Limited in Some Countries
Unavailable in the U.S., parts of the UK, Canada, and others. Not yet registered with Bappebti (Indonesia’s regulator).
3. Withdrawal/Deposit Limits
Restrictions apply unless you verify your account (KYC) or hold OKB tokens.
